Overview

The sparrow is a small bird mentioned in the Bible, often symbolizing God's care for creation and the value of human life in His eyes.

Sparrows were common in the ancient Near East, often seen as insignificant creatures. Their mention in scripture highlights God's attention to even the smallest details of life.

Key verses

  1. Matthew 10:31Jesus reassures His followers that they are of more value than many sparrows, highlighting God's love and concern for humanity.
  2. Psalm 102:7The psalmist expresses a feeling of loneliness akin to a bird alone on a roof, illustrating the emotional and spiritual significance of the sparrow.

Notable passages

  1. Matthew 10:29-31Jesus teaches that not one sparrow falls to the ground without the Father's knowledge, emphasizing God's intimate care for all His creation.
  2. Psalm 84:3The psalmist expresses a longing for God's presence, noting that even the sparrow finds a home near the altar of God.
  3. Luke 12:6-7Similar to Matthew, this passage reiterates that sparrows are sold for a small price, yet God values each person far more.
